The average temperature decrease of -6.5 degrees/km celsius is known as ________. group of answer choices dry adiabatic rate normal lapse rate stability environmental lapse rate maximum mixing depth
The average temperature decrease of -6.5 degrees/km Celsius is known as Normal lapse rate.
Normal lapse rate is defined as the decrease in the temperature while moving upwards in the atmosphere. Normally, the rate of decrease is 1 degree Celsius for every 165 meter rise in altitude or we can say that it is 6.5 degree Celsius for every 1 km rise in altitude.
This lapse rate is known as normal lapse rate or environmental lapse rate.
This is why when we move higher in the atmosphere, we experience low temperatures. On average this decrease is equal to the amount of temperature as discussed in the normal lapse rate.

Researchers are interested in determining whether more women than men prefer the beach to the mountains. In a random sample of 200 women, 45% prefer the beach, whereas in a random sample of 300 men, 52% prefer the beach. What is the 99% confidence interval estimate for the difference between the percentages of women and men who prefer the beach over the mountains?
Answer:
The 99% confidence interval estimate for the difference between the percentage of women and men who prefer the beach over the mountains is -18.72% < (p₁ - p₂) < 4.72%
Step-by-step explanation:
The given parameters are;
Sample size of the women sample, n₁ = 200
Percentage of the women that prefer beach, p₁ = 45%, \(\hat p_1\) = 0.45
Sample size of the men sample n₂ = 300
Percentage of the men that prefer beach, p₂ = 52%, \(\hat p_2\) = 0.52
Confidence level of the confidence interval = 99%
α = 1 - 0.99 = 0.01, therefore, α/2 = 0.005
The equation for the confidence interval for the difference between two proportions is given as follows;
\(\left (\hat{p}_{1} - \hat{p}_{2} \right )\pm z_{\alpha /2}\sqrt{\dfrac{\hat{p}_{1}(1-\hat{p}_{1})}{n_{1}}+\dfrac{\hat{p}_{2}(1-\hat{p}_{2})}{n_{2}}}\)
\(z_{\alpha /2}\) = ±2.57 from the z score tables
Plugging in the vales, we have;
\(\left (0.45 - 0.52 \right )\pm 2.57\sqrt{\dfrac{0.45(1-0.45)}{200}+\dfrac{0.52(1-0.52)}{300}}\)
Which gives;
-0.1872 < \((\hat p_1 - \hat p_2)\) < 0.0472
The 99% confidence interval estimate for the difference between the percentage of women and men who prefer the beach over the mountains = -18.72% < (p₁ - p₂) < 4.72%.
find the limit. use l'hospital's rule where appropriate. if there is a more elementary method, consider using it. lim x→0 6x − sin(6x) 6x − tan(6x)
Answer:
-1/2
Step-by-step explanation:
You want the limit as x→0 of the ratio (6x -sin(6x))/(6x -tan(6x)).
L'Hôpital's ruleThe given expression evaluates at x=0 to (0 -0)/(0 -0) = 0/0, an indeterminate form. Hence, L'Hôpital's rule applies.
The ratio of derivatives of the numerator and denominator is ...
(6 -6cos(6x))/(6 -6sec²(6x))
which still evaluates to 0/0 at x=0.
Applying L'Hôpital's rule a second time gives ...
\(\dfrac{36\sin(6x)}{-72\sec^2(6x)\tan(6x)}=\dfrac{-\cos^3(6x)}{2}\)
At x=0, this evaluates to -1/2.
The limit as x→0 is -1/2.
